Underground sewage deposits can be paid using old currency notes says Coimbatore corporation Commissioner


Coimbatore Corporation Commissioner and presiding officer K. Vijaya Karthikeyan said “The works on underground drainage system has been completed in a few areas under the Coimbatore Corporation. The house owners from the respective areas can pay their deposits for connecting the drainage to the underground drainage system using the demonetised Rs.500 and Rs.1000 currency notes. Deposits can be made at the Chinthamani tax collection centre which is situated in the 12th ward of the Coimbatore Corporation. South Zone residents can pay their deposits at the Ponnaiya Rajapuram health inspector's office.”

The Corporation Commissioner added that residents from the old corporation zones can also pay their deposits using the old currency notes. The connections will be provided to these residents once the respective works are over. If there is any variation in the deposit amount the respective difference should be subsequently be paid. The deposits can also be paid at all zonal offices and special camps using the 500 and 1000 rupees currency notes.
